defmodule Microwaveprop.Workers.PropagationPruneWorker do @moduledoc """ Standalone worker that prunes stale rows from `propagation_scores`. Pruning used to be tacked on to the end of `PropagationGridWorker.perform/1`, which meant it only ran after a successful grid compute. When the compute worker was being killed mid-run (OOM / SIGTERM), prune never ran and the table grew unbounded. Running prune on its own cron keeps the table healthy regardless of the compute worker's state. """ use Oban.Pro.Worker, queue: :propagation, # Lower priority than PropagationGridWorker so the hourly chain # never waits behind a pending prune on the shared :propagation # queue (2 slots). priority: 5, max_attempts: 3, unique: [period: 300, states: :incomplete] alias Microwaveprop.Propagation @impl Oban.Pro.Worker def process(%Oban.Job{}) do Propagation.prune_old_scores() :ok end end
